Job Description

Children's Residential Counselor (Ages 6 - 13)


New Alternatives is seeking a qualified, motivated individual to join our team. New Alternatives works with children and youth at their residential home site who have experienced child abuse. The applicant will gain experience working within a residential treatment setting and will learn the skills necessary for de-escalation, emotional support, and behavioral support with clients at a high level of care treatment placement.


Shifts Available: Sunday- Thursday 11 pm-7am

                              Friday -  Tuesday  3pm-11pm 

Bachelor’s Degree in Human Services, Social Work, Psychology or related field is preferred.

  • Must possess a valid California Driver’s License, proof of automobile insurance and have access to reliable automobile
  • at least 6 months of experience working with children (volunteer work is acceptable)


Responsibilities include but are not limited to :

  • Provide support to the child and family
  • Ensuring the safety and supervision of the clients.
  • Assist in coordination of transportation of youth.
  • Capability to establish and maintain appropriate boundaries with the child and family
  • Applicant needs to have patience, compassion, and confidence to work with a population of clients that have severe emotional dysregulation and behavioral instability.
  • Maintain updated accurate daily log of services provided
